Joe Biden repeated a whopper about inflation on Tuesday during an interview with Yahoo Finance, stating that the economic measure was “at nine percent when I came in, and now it’s down around three percent.” 

Just a week prior, the president told CNN’s Erin Burnett that “it was nine percent when I came to office, nine percent” when asked about the ongoing inflation crisis crushing the middle class. Biden seems to have settled on telling this lie over and over for one reason or another, of which some of the possibilities I’ll explore.


READ: Biden Interview With Erin Burnett Is Hilarious Exercise in Childish Denial and Straight-Up Lying


Getting the fact-checking out the way, it is not even close to true that inflation was at nine percent when Biden took office. On the contrary, it was only at 1.4 percent. Even before the pandemic, it was well within the normal federal reserve range of two percent. Inflation only began to spike in the months after the current president took office, with his signing of the American Rescue Plan, another two trillion boondoggle, injecting yet more deficit-financed cash into an already overheated economy. 

Inflation didn’t reach nine percent until the summer of 2022, over a year and a half after Biden was sworn in. It’s hard to think of a more blatant lie, but I’m sure if we give the president time, he’ll come up with something. 

The claim that inflation is “down around three percent today” could be true depending on how much of a round down you want to give Biden. Technically, inflation in March of 2024 (the last report as of this writing) was at 3.5 percent, and all signs suggest we are going to see another spike when the April 2024 report comes out.
